Businesses urged to apply for grants ahead of application deadlines
Wiltshire Council is reminding any businesses that have not yet applied for Local Restrictions Support Grants (LRSG) to do so as soon as they can, as the closing dates for applications are fast approaching.

The deadline for new LRSG applications for the period of November 2020 to January 2021 is 31 March; while the closing date for new applications for the LRSG relating to the period 16 February 2021 to 5 April 2021 is 31 May. This is for new applications only - any business that has previously been awarded a LRSG will automatically be paid again for these periods, and they do not need to contact the council.
In the recent Budget, the Chancellor announced that the LRSG will be replaced by the Restart Grant scheme from 5 April 2021. This new scheme will support high street businesses as they recover from the COVID-19 pandemic, and the new grants will be worth up to £6,000 for non-essential retail, and up to £18,000 for hospitality businesses such as pubs and hotels.
The council is awaiting more information from the Government on the Restart Grant, including how much it will be able to grant to support Wiltshire businesses.
Sam Fox, Corporate Director for Place and Environment, said: "These deadlines are fast approaching, so I would urge any Wiltshire businesses that have not yet applied for a LRSG to do so as soon as they can.
"Any business that has already received a LRSG payment need not apply again as they will be paid automatically.
"We will soon be working on the new Restart Grants scheme, but I would ask people please not to contact us about this, as this may delay our officers as they pay grants. As soon as we have more information on the Restart Grants we will share it with Wiltshire businesses on our website, social media channels and in our business newsletter.
"We have paid out more than 27,000 grant awards totalling over £135m during this pandemic, and we will continue to do all we can to support Wiltshire businesses during this difficult time."
